Understanding the Debilitating Nature of Narcolepsy in Patients’ Own Words: A Social Listening Analysis

Background Narcolepsy is a rare, chronic hypersomnolence disorder characterized by debilitating symptoms, including excessive daytime sleepiness (EDS), cataplexy, and disrupted nighttime sleep. Symptoms most typically appear during adolescence2; however, previous reports suggest that diagnosis can be complicated by lack of symptom recognition or misdiagnoses and may be delayed by >10 years.
